I think that the biggest reason that Olrox is widely pegged as being a sort of unofficial heir to Dracula's throne is because out of all the vampires we've seen in the series who are not Dracula, Olrox's abilities --both in nature and in scope-- veer closest to Dracula's. He's very much a Dracula-lite. Furthermore, once upon a time he was a close enough ally of Dracula to be given partial command over Dracula's forces and maintained his own part of the Castle.
